2 Precautions for Installation and Operation

2.1 Operating Environment

The following environment is required for consistent performance of the Scanner:
Temperature: 50 to 95°F (10 to 35°C) with temperature variations not exceeding 18°F (10°C)
per hour.
Humidity: 15 to 85%RH with humidity variation not exceeding 20% per hour.

2.2 Precautions when operating the Scanner

Observe the following precautions to ensure the optimum performance of the Scanner:

NEVER place any object or exert shock on the Scanner.

NEVER place finger(s) between the glass when operating the Scanner.

 NEVER bring any magnetized object or use flammable sprays/liquids near the Scanner.
 NEVER place a vase or vessel containing water on the Scanner.
 NEVER drop paper clips, staples, or other small pieces of metal into the Scanner. If this

occurs, contact your Authorized Dealer.

 NEVER remove the Fixed Outer Cover.
 ALWAYS completely insert the Power Cord Plug into the Power Outlet.
 ALWAYS make sure that the outlet into which the Power Cord Plug is inserted is visible.
 NEVER use this device with Power Cords or USB Cables for other electrical devices.
 IMMEDIATELY turn the Power Switch OFF, unplug the Power Cord, and call your

authorized dealer for appropriate action when the Power Cord or USB Cable of the Scanner
has been damaged.

 ALWAYS be sure to turn the Power Switch OFF, unplug the Power Cord, and call your

authorized dealer for appropriate action when the Scanner becomes excessively hot or
produces abnormal noise.
